Education is a priority in Beulah!

Beulah knows youth are the future of every community and has invested in local education. Beulah School District #27 is the public school district in the area, with one elementary school, one middle school and one high school. Small class sizes are the norm in Beulah, with an average of 13.4 students per teacher, compared to the national average of nearly 17.

Post-secondary options in the region offer students the opportunity to prepare for their futures. Bismarck State College is North Dakota’s Polytechnic Institution and a Top 150 Aspen Prize winner for Community College Excellence in 2021. Williston State College offers associate degrees and certificates in general, vocational, technical education and workforce training programs. Nearby Dickinson State University was North Dakota’s first dual mission institution in 2018, expanding its educational offerings beyond bachelor’s degree programs to that necessary to support workforce advancement in the growing region. Specific programming includes continuing education, certifications, associate degrees, graduate degrees and training for community needs like Commercial Driver’s Licensing and Certified Nursing Assistants.
